Architectural Pattern Recognition using Convolutional Neural Networks
Identifies repeated structural patterns in text across six hierarchical levels: phrase, line, paragraph/list/table/title, chunk, section, and document. Higher levels are built from recurring lower-level patterns, revealing the structural DNA of the content. Outputs results in YAML or JSON for analysis, templating, and validation.
